AIRWORTHINESS DIRECTIVE

On the effective date specified below, and for the reasons set out in the background section, the CASA delegate whose signature appears below revokes Airworthiness Directive AD/DHC-1/1.

De Havilland DHC-1 (Chipmunk) Series Aeroplanes

AD/DHC-1/1 Tailplane Bracket Bolt - Locking 10/2008

Requirement:

CANCELLED.

This AD is cancelled on 25 September 2008.

Background:

This unique Australian AD raised in 1950 against documents DH TNS CTR No.135; or Air Ministry Modification Chipmunk No. H.47 or ANO 104.1.14.15.5.1, required a modification by reversal of bolts securing the tailplane attachment brackets to the aft face of the rear fuselage bulkhead, and replacing the Aerotight nuts with new standard nuts.  Compliance was required forthwith.

As all affected aircraft would have been modified by now, this AD is no longer required.
